BMP to PCX Conversion Explained
Converting .BMP to .PCX changes an uncompressed Windows Bitmap into a PC Paintbrush image. This process takes raw pixel data and applies Run-Length Encoding (RLE) compression. Users perform this conversion almost exclusively to interact with legacy software, retro game engines, or older industrial hardware.
When you convert bmp to pcx, you gain compatibility with MS-DOS era systems and reduce file size for images with large areas of flat color. However, you lose modern operating system support. Most modern devices cannot preview .PCX files natively. Additionally, if your .BMP is a 32-bit image with an alpha channel, you will lose all transparency because .PCX does not support it.
This conversion is a bad idea for web publishing, modern app development, or general archiving. If you need a compressed, lossless image for modern use, you should convert to .PNG instead.
Typical Tasks and Users
- Retro Game Modders: Developers modifying 1990s game engines (like the Build engine used in Duke Nukem 3D or the id Tech engines) require .PCX files for textures and UI elements.
- Industrial Technicians: Operators of older CNC machines, point-of-sale systems, or embedded hardware often need to upload boot logos or interface graphics in .PCX format.
- Software Archivists: Researchers restoring or emulating MS-DOS software environments convert modern .BMP screenshots or assets into .PCX to read them inside emulators.

Pros and Cons of the Conversion
Pros:
- Legacy Compatibility: .PCX is universally recognized by MS-DOS software and early Windows applications.
- Basic Compression: The RLE algorithm reduces file sizes for simple graphics, logos, and pixel art without losing quality.
Cons:
- Poor Photo Compression: RLE compression is inefficient for noisy images or photographs. Converting a complex .BMP photo to .PCX can actually increase the file size.
- No Transparency: .PCX cannot store alpha channels. Transparent backgrounds in 32-bit .BMP files will render as solid colors.
- Limited Color Depth: .PCX maxes out at 24-bit color.
- Obsolete Format: You cannot view .PCX files in standard web browsers or modern OS preview tools.
Conversion Difficulties & Why Convert.Guru
Converting .BMP to .PCX involves specific technical hurdles. First, .BMP files typically store pixel rows from bottom to top, while .PCX stores them from top to bottom. The conversion pipeline must flip the row order in memory before encoding. Second, converting a 24-bit .BMP to an 8-bit .PCX requires generating an optimal 256-color palette. Poor palette mapping results in severe color banding. Finally, poorly written RLE encoders can bloat the file size if they fail to handle non-repeating pixel sequences correctly.

BMP vs. PCX: What is the better choice?
| Feature | BMP | PCX |
| Compression | None (Usually) | RLE (Lossless) |
| Transparency | Yes (32-bit Alpha) | No |
| Native OS Support | Windows, macOS, Linux | None (Requires third-party apps) |
Which format should you choose?
Choose .BMP when you need a simple, uncompressed format for local Windows applications or when you are saving intermediate edits and want to avoid compression artifacts.
Choose .PCX only when a specific legacy application, retro game engine, or older industrial machine explicitly requires it.
Avoid both formats for modern web use, email sharing, or photo storage. For those tasks, convert your images to .PNG or .JPEG.
